[cp-patches] [patch] port GdkGraphics2D to Cairo 0.5.0


From: Thomas Fitzsimmons
Subject: [cp-patches] [patch] port GdkGraphics2D to Cairo 0.5.0
Date: Wed, 08 Jun 2005 17:37:16 -0400

Hi,

I committed this patch to mainline.  It updates GdkGraphics2D to use the
latest Cairo APIs.  I ran their "cairo-api-update" script over the
sources and updated other instances by hand.  This means that Cairo >
0.5.0 is required when building with --enable-gtk-cairo.

Tom

2005-06-08  Thomas Fitzsimmons  <address@hidden>

        * gnu/java/awt/peer/gtk/GdkGraphics2D.java (cairoSetRGBColor,
        cairoSetAlpha): Combine ...
        (cairoSetRGBAColor): New method.
        * include/gnu_java_awt_peer_gtk_GdkGraphics2D.h: Regenerate.
        * include/gnu_java_awt_peer_gtk_GtkImage.h: Regenerate.
        * native/jni/gtk-peer/gnu_java_awt_peer_gtk_GdkGraphics2D.c: Use
        Cairo 0.5.0 APIs.
        * INSTALL: Document Cairo 0.5.0 requirement.
        * NEWS: Likewise.
        * configure.ac: Require Cairo 0.5.0.
